Christy gets streaming release date on HBO Max
Warner Bros. Discovery’s April release schedule confirms that HBO Max will begin streaming Christy on April 10. The platform includes the film among its new monthly titles, marking its subscription streaming debut following its theatrical run and earlier digital availability on other platforms.
The biographical sports drama centers on professional boxer Christy Martin and traces her rise in the sport alongside personal struggles. The official logline states: “Christy Martin (Sydney Sweeney) never imagined life beyond her small-town roots in West Virginia—until she discovered a knack for punching people.”
The film follows her career under trainer and husband Jim, played by Ben Foster, while depicting conflicts beyond the ring. The synopsis adds: “Fueled by grit, raw determination, and an unshakable desire to win, she charges into the world of boxing under the guidance of her trainer and manager-turned-husband, Jim.”
Christy previously premiered at the Toronto International Film Festival on September 5 before opening in U.S. theaters on November 7. It later became available to rent or purchase on platforms including Prime Video, Apple TV, and YouTube prior to its HBO Max streaming release.
The cast includes Sydney Sweeney in the title role alongside Ben Foster, Merritt Weaver, and Katy O’Brian. David Michôd directs the film. The release forms part of HBO Max’s April lineup.
